Erks
Erfahrenes Mitglied
Hi,
mal eine Frage:
ich wollte mal von dem komfortablen Visual Studio weg und mal versuchen unter LINUX Programme zu schreiben. Jetzt das Problem, wie kann ich auf Klassen zugreigen und wie gebe ich das dann in diesem "g++ ...." des Terminals an?
Hier mal mein Code (Den konnte ich ja auch nicht testen, ob der funktioniert...)
main.cpp
test.h
test.cpp
Schon mal danke für die Hilfe
mal eine Frage:
ich wollte mal von dem komfortablen Visual Studio weg und mal versuchen unter LINUX Programme zu schreiben. Jetzt das Problem, wie kann ich auf Klassen zugreigen und wie gebe ich das dann in diesem "g++ ...." des Terminals an?
Hier mal mein Code (Den konnte ich ja auch nicht testen, ob der funktioniert...)
main.cpp
Code:
#include <iostream>
#include "test.h"
using namespace std;
int main(){
Test t(2);
cout << t.getZahl() << endl;
return 0;
}
test.h
Code:
class Test{
public:
int z;
Test(int a);
~Test();
int getZahl();
};
test.cpp
Code:
#include <iostream>
#include "test.h"
using namespace std;
Test::Test(int a){
z = a;
}
int Test::getZahl(){
return z;
}
Schon mal danke für die Hilfe
